The Chernobyl disaster occurred April 26, 1986 with the explosion of reactor number 4 of the Chernobyl nuclear power plant in Ukraine (then part of the Soviet Union), near the border with Belarus. Following the explosion, the central raised clouds of radioactive material that reached the ' Eastern Europe and Scandinavia as well as the western part of the USSR. Vast areas were close to the central heavily contaminated necessitating the evacuation and resettlement in other areas of approximately 336,000 people. The republics, now separate, Ukraine, Belarus and Russia are still burdened by high costs of decontamination and the high incidence of tumors and malformations on the inhabitants of the affected area.
"Studies show that 34,499 people took part in the cleanup of Chernobyl have died of cancer after the catastrophe," said Nikolai Omelyanetes, deputy head of the National Commission for Radiation Protection of Ukraine, also the second Nikolai the infant mortality rate has increased from 20 to 30%.
